The difference between a meaningful story and a medical conclusion

A narrative can change how a reader thinks about grief, uncertainty, or professional identity without proving why an event happened. That distinction protects both the emotional value of the account and the standards used for medical evidence.

Read for what the narrator noticed, what remains undocumented, and which interpretation was added afterward. The strongest response is neither automatic belief nor automatic dismissal; it is careful attention to the boundary between observation and explanation.

Five checkpoints for this route

  1. 1.Is a personal belief clearly labeled instead of presented as medical consensus?
  2. 2.Does the conclusion match what was measured rather than what was merely possible?
  3. 3.Are observation and interpretation written as separate statements?
  4. 4.Would the wording still be accurate if the preferred explanation were wrong?
  5. 5.Was the account recorded close to the event or reconstructed much later?
